KFDM 6 News is reporting that Jefferson County District Attorney Pat Knauth has confirmed that an investigation will be launched into Beaumont Mayor Becky Ames recently receiving service at a nail shop, which was captured in a photo and then provided to the media.

Knauth said that the investigation comes at the request of Jefferson County Judge Jeff Brannick and they will try to determine whether there is a criminal case, and when or whether they’ll be able to assemble a jury.

According to Knauth, the case will be turned over to an unspecified law enforcement agency for impartiality and they will be charged with determining if any criminal conduct occurred, whether by Ames, or, The Nail Bar on Old Dowlen Road.

Currently, all nail and hair businesses statewide are ordered closed by Texas Governor Greg Abbott in an attempt to stop the spread of Coronavirus. State officials say a violation, if followed by a conviction, could result in a fine of up to $2,000.00 and a jail term up to 6 months.
